Moin Leute
Habe mal ne einfache Frage.
Ich möchte in C einen Integer über die Pfeiltasten erhöhen oder verkleinern.
Mein Problem ist nur das ich nicht weiß wie ich die Pfeiltasten abfragen kann.
Eine einfache abfrage mit fgets() funzt nicht wirklich (oder ich weiß nicht wie).
EVTl. reicht es auch wenn Ihr nur Stichwörter Postet damit ich überhaupt erstmal weiß wonach ich googlen könnte.
MFG
Timo O.
Pfeiltasten
Re: Pfeiltasten
Du wirst mit der ncurses-Bibliothek arbeiten müssen. Traditionell waren früher an UNIX-Rechner Terminals angeschlossen. Diese konnten natürlich von verschiedenen Herstellern sein und waren (sind) von den Steuersequenzen her (um den Bildschirm zu löschen oder Cursor zu positionieren) und den von den einzelnen Tasten geschickten Escape-Sequenzen zueinander imkompatibel. Der termcap/terminfo-Mechanismus stellt da eine Zwischenschicht dar; ncurses macht das ganze dann bequemer zu benutzen.Links und Infos zu ncurses findest Du in diesem Thread: <a href="http://www.pl-forum.de/cgi-bin/UltraBoa ... 0&Session=" target="_blank"><!--auto-->http://www.pl-forum.de/cgi-bin/UltraBoa ... <!--auto-->
Viel Spass!
Jochen
Viel Spass!
Jochen
Re: Pfeiltasten
Da auch etwas Beispielprog zu ncurses:
<a href="http://www.pronix.de/" target="_blank"><!--auto-->http://www.pronix.de/</a><!--auto-->
<a href="http://www.pronix.de/" target="_blank"><!--auto-->http://www.pronix.de/</a><!--auto-->